New Hard Drive Discovered, Do You Want to Register?
OK, this is really getting me upset. Acronis True Image 2012 on W7K Pro 64-bit since December 2011. I purchased the 2012 0n December 20, 2011, for this new computer build. This morning during backup, I get: "New hard drive discovered, do you want to register?" so I said yes, now it says "Too many activations. Resolve Problem". This is the same hard drive I have been using since I purchased 2012. So I go to the Acronis support site to open ticket and it says: Your support expired January 2012, so it was good for one month whoopee!
Why in the world would anyone in their right mind purchase 2013 with this kind of stuff going on?
Unless someone has a better idea I am going to uninstall and go with a better option.
Ideas to fix?

You can follow the procedure in this KB article: http://kb.acronis.com/content/22154. The article was written to be able to move an existing license from one computer to another, but you can use it to remove the license from your current computer and then you will be able to re-activate your installed copy.
In addition, you should not be charged for support concerning activation issues when contacting support here: http://www.acronis.com/support/contact-us.html.
When you are on the support page, in step 1, in the left hand side pulldown, select "customer care", and in the right hand side pulldown, select "product activation issues". You then will be able to use email and live chat, your choice.
Be sure to check to see if you have the current build (7133) of 2012 installed on your system. I believe that this problem may have been resovled in the later builds.
